    No i don't mine. But for comparison i can provide data from some other folks. From STH. EPYC 7702 Cinebench - 19589 Dual XEON Platinum 8136 - 14525 43000 H/sec Monero on EPYC 7702 21000 H/sec on dual 8136

    So the CPU Is an OEM CPU and AMD puts ES in the processor name for anything that is non-retail. Unlike Retail it can be OC'd but otherwise identical to Retail. Hence way cheaper than retail.
